A packing machine is an automated industrial equipment designed to streamline the process of packaging products across various industries. This sophisticated machinery handles multiple packaging tasks, including filling, sealing, wrapping, labeling, and palletizing, significantly reducing manual labor while increasing production efficiency. Modern packing machine technology incorporates advanced sensors, programmable logic controllers, and precision mechanisms to ensure consistent packaging quality and speed. These machines can handle diverse product types, from food and beverages to pharmaceuticals, cosmetics, and consumer goods. The packing machine operates through integrated systems that measure, portion, and secure products into containers, bags, boxes, or bottles with minimal human intervention. Key technological features include adjustable speed controls, automatic error detection, user-friendly touchscreen interfaces, and compatibility with different packaging materials. Many contemporary packing machine models offer modular designs that allow manufacturers to customize configurations based on specific production requirements. The applications span across multiple sectors including food processing plants, pharmaceutical manufacturing facilities, chemical industries, and e-commerce fulfillment centers. By automating repetitive packaging tasks, a packing machine ensures product protection during transportation, extends shelf life through proper sealing, and maintains hygiene standards required by regulatory bodies. Advanced Automation Technology for Maximum Efficiency

Advanced Automation Technology for Maximum Efficiency

Modern packing machine systems incorporate cutting-edge automation technology that revolutionizes production workflows. These machines feature sophisticated programmable logic controllers that manage complex packaging sequences with precision timing, ensuring seamless coordination between filling, sealing, and labeling operations. The integrated servo motor systems provide exceptional speed control and positioning accuracy, allowing the packing machine to adjust instantly to different product specifications without manual recalibration. Advanced sensor arrays monitor every stage of the packaging process, detecting anomalies such as missing labels, improper seals, or incorrect fill levels, then automatically rejecting defective packages before they enter the distribution chain. The intuitive touchscreen interfaces allow operators to modify settings, switch between product recipes, and monitor real-time performance metrics without specialized technical training. This automation technology reduces changeover times between production runs from hours to minutes, maximizing your equipment utilization and enabling cost-effective small-batch production. The self-diagnostic capabilities identify maintenance needs before breakdowns occur, minimizing unexpected downtime and extending the operational lifespan of your packing machine investment.

Versatile Design Accommodating Multiple Packaging Formats

The adaptability of a quality packing machine makes it invaluable for businesses with diverse product portfolios or evolving market demands. These machines accommodate an impressive range of packaging formats including stand-up pouches, flat bags, rigid containers, flexible films, boxes, and shrink-wrapped bundles. The modular architecture allows you to add or remove components such as dosing systems, zipper applicators, gusseting stations, and date coders based on specific requirements. This versatility means your packing machine investment remains relevant as your product mix changes, eliminating the need for multiple specialized machines. The adjustable forming tubes, changeable molds, and flexible conveyor systems enable quick transitions between different package sizes and shapes, supporting everything from single-serve portions to bulk packaging. Whether you are packaging granular products, liquids, powders, or solid items, the packing machine can be configured with appropriate filling mechanisms including auger fillers, volumetric cups, or multi-head weighers. This adaptability extends to packaging materials as well, with systems capable of handling various film thicknesses, laminate structures, and sustainable eco-friendly materials that increasingly appeal to environmentally conscious consumers and meet regulatory requirements.

Enhanced Product Protection and Extended Shelf Life

A professional packing machine delivers superior product protection that preserves quality from production line to end consumer. The precision sealing systems create airtight, moisture-resistant barriers that prevent contamination, oxidation, and degradation of sensitive products. For food applications, the packing machine can integrate modified atmosphere packaging technology that replaces oxygen with protective gases, dramatically extending perishable product shelf life without artificial preservatives. The consistent seal integrity achieved through controlled temperature, pressure, and dwell time parameters ensures package reliability that manual methods cannot match. This protection reduces product returns, minimizes waste throughout the distribution channel, and maintains the sensory qualities that drive consumer satisfaction and repeat purchases. The tamper-evident features integrated into modern packing machine designs provide security assurance that builds consumer trust in your brand. For pharmaceutical and nutraceutical applications, the packing machine operates in controlled environments with validation protocols that meet stringent regulatory standards for product safety and traceability. The barrier properties of properly sealed packages protect light-sensitive, moisture-sensitive, and oxygen-sensitive products, maintaining potency and efficacy throughout the declared shelf life while reducing the need for expensive secondary packaging.
